Case study

A flooded vacation rental, rent-ready in 5 days.

When a short-term rental management company had a tub-overflow leak damage a bedroom, closet, and bath on Oasis Drive in Escondido, the unit was off the booking calendar and losing income by the day. Here's how we turned it around in a single work week.

  1. Day 1
    Emergency response & mitigation

    Stop the water, start the drying

    Same-day water extraction and containment, antimicrobial treatment, and commercial drying equipment set in place. Our plumber located and corrected the tub spout / overflow leak at its source and pressure-tested the repair.

    Water damage and mold exposed along the baseboard at an Escondido short-term rental
  2. Day 2
    Structural drying & teardown

    Dry to standard, remove what's lost

    Moisture readings monitored to verified-dry levels, then damaged drywall in the bath and closet was removed so nothing wet got sealed behind the new build. The work area stayed sealed off to protect the rest of the unit.

    Damaged drywall removed and a commercial dehumidifier running during structural drying
  3. Day 3
    Rebuild begins

    New drywall and fixtures

    Fresh drywall hung, taped, and finished in the closet and bathroom, and the toilet reset - bringing the rooms back to a paintable, finishable state while final drying wrapped up.

    Drying equipment running in the bathroom during the restoration
  4. Day 4
    Flooring

    New LVP, expanded to match

    Luxury vinyl plank installed over a fresh moisture barrier in the closet and the bedroom - extended into the adjoining space so the finished floor looked intentional, not patched.

    New luxury vinyl plank flooring being installed over a fresh moisture barrier
  5. Day 5
    Finish & handoff

    Trim, paint, detail — back online

    New baseboard and trim carpentry installed and caulked, walls primed and painted, and furniture staged as it was - the finish-quality touches that make a unit feel genuinely guest-ready, not just patched. A final walkthrough video and completion report, and the property was back on the booking calendar five days from the first call.

    The finished, staged bedroom restored and back to rent-ready

Result: From active water damage to rent-ready in 5 days, with a professional completion report the owner could hand straight to their insurer.
